Denmark outlines agricultural priorities in EU Presidency – Swine information


On 15 July, Jacob Jensen, Denmark’s Minister for Meals, Agriculture and Fisheries, introduced the principle agricultural priorities of the Danish Presidency of the Council to the European Parliament’s Committee on Agriculture and Rural Improvement. Denmark holds the rotating Presidency till the top of 2025.


In accordance with Jensen, the Presidency will deal with easing the executive burden for farmers whereas persevering with to advertise the inexperienced transition and enhance animal welfare. A key precedence will probably be to conclude the continued negotiations on the widespread agricultural coverage (CAP) simplification bundle, whereas additionally beginning discussions on the CAP framework past 2027.


A number of Members of the European Parliament (MEPs) raised issues concerning truthful circumstances for EU farmers within the context of the Mercosur Settlement and animal welfare requirements. Questions had been additionally requested on how the Presidency intends to assist EU protein and fertiliser self-sufficiency and to offer stronger backing for natural farming.


Different MEPs highlighted the significance of guaranteeing that the inexperienced transition doesn’t undermine the long-term sustainability of the agricultural sector. The Presidency’s dedication to balancing simplification with bold local weather and sustainability targets will due to this fact be a central theme within the months forward.
